gcr.io/heptio-images/ks-guestbook-demo是Heptio团队推出的一款Kubernetes演示镜像,专为展示集群内服务发现与负载均衡机制设计。作为轻量级实践工具,它通过一个简单的Guestbook应用,帮助用户直观理解K8s核心功能的工作逻辑。
这款镜像的核心价值在于“场景化演示”。其搭载的Guestbook应用是一个基础留言板工具,用户可提交、查看留言,数据则通过etcd存储——etcd作为Kubernetes常用的分布式键值数据库,能确保留言数据的持久化与集群内一致性。不过,应用本身只是载体,真正要呈现的是Kubernetes如何让这样的分布式应用“顺畅通信”。
具体来看,服务发现功能在这里体现为“动态寻址”:Guestbook应用无需硬编码etcd服务的IP地址,而是通过K8s的Service资源自动定位目标服务。当etcd实例扩缩容或IP变化时,K8s会实时更新Service的 endpoint 信息,确保应用始终能找到正确的依赖服务。而负载均衡则解决“请求分发”问题:若Guestbook以多Pod形式部署,K8s Service会将用户请求均匀分配到不同Pod实例,避免单节点过载,同时实现故障自动转移——某个Pod异常时,请求会自动路由到健康实例,提升整体可用性。
对于Kubernetes初学者或开发团队,这款镜像的优势在于“低门槛实践”。无需搭建复杂环境,部署后即可通过日志和集群状态观察服务发现的动态更新过程、负载均衡的请求分发效果,快速建立对“Service如何关联Pod”“集群内服务如何通信”的直观认知。无论是作为入门教程的配套案例,还是开发环境中演示微服务协作的示例,它都能帮助用户将抽象的K8s概念转化为可操作的实际场景,是理解集群服务管理的实用工具。
请登录使用轩辕镜像享受快速拉取体验,支持国内访问优化,速度提升
docker pull gcr.io/heptio-images/ks-guestbook-demo:0.1manifest unknown 错误
TLS 证书验证失败
DNS 解析超时
410 错误:版本过低
402 错误:流量耗尽
身份认证失败错误
429 限流错误
凭证保存错误
来自真实用户的反馈,见证轩辕镜像的优质服务